Failure to Meet Ethical Standards

In a report by The Guardian earlier this week, Deloitte is being fined £14 million after they were found to have “failed to meet ethical and public interest standards”. In addition, “Maghsoud Einollahi, a former director of the accountancy firm, was fined £250,000 and given a three-year ban from accountancy” –  a severe penalty for failing “to consider a conflict of interest in which the firm benefited from the schemes devised by the Phoenix Four”.
